H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ES

N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ING

 

COMMITTEE:    Appropriations - S/C on Infrastructure, Resiliency & Invest 

TIME & DATE:  7:30 AM, Wednesday, April 3, 2019 

PLACE:       E1.030 
CHAIR:       Rep. Giovanni Capriglione 

 

*** HB 2154 and HJR 145 were added to the posting ***

 

The House Appropriations Subcommittee on State Infrastructure, Resiliency, and Investments will meet to consider the following bills:

 

HB 20          Capriglione | et al.
Relating to the allocation of certain constitutional transfers of money to the economic stabilization fund, the Texas legacy fund, and the state highway fund and to the management and investment of the economic stabilization fund, the Texas legacy fund, and the Texas legacy distribution fund.

HB 274         Davis, Sarah | et al.
Relating to the creation of the disaster reinvestment and infrastructure planning revolving fund and the permissible uses of that fund; making an appropriation.

HB 690         Metcalf
Relating to dedicating certain state revenue to the purpose of retiring state debt.

HB 1562        Frullo
Relating to the allocation and use of the annual constitutional appropriation to certain agencies and institutions of higher education.

HB 2154        Landgraf | et al.
Relating to the allocation of certain constitutional transfers of money to the economic stabilization fund, the state highway fund, and the generate recurring oil wealth for Texas (GROW Texas) fund and to the permissible uses of money deposited to the generate recurring oil wealth for Texas (GROW Texas) fund.

HJR 10         Capriglione | et al.
Proposing a constitutional amendment providing for the creation of the Texas legacy fund and the Texas legacy distribution fund, dedicating earnings on the Texas legacy distribution fund to certain state infrastructure projects or the reduction of certain long-term obligations, and providing for the transfer of certain general revenues to the economic stabilization fund, the Texas legacy fund, and the state highway fund.

HJR 82         Craddick | et al.
Proposing a constitutional amendment providing for the creation of and use of money in the generate recurring oil wealth for Texas (GROW Texas) fund and allocating certain general revenues to that fund, the economic stabilization fund, and the state highway fund.

HJR 145        Davis, Sarah
Proposing a constitutional amendment authorizing the issuance of general obligation bonds to provide financial assistance to political subdivisions located in areas of the state affected by a disaster.

Testimony may be limited to 3 minutes.

 

 

Notice of this meeting was announced from the house floor.
